Symptoms of renal failure in dogs

1. It is divided into two stages: azotemia and uremia.
2. When azotemia occurs, no obvious clinical symptoms may be seen, and blood tests may change.
3. When uremia occurs, it is a multi-system poisoning syndrome, with clinical symptoms related to azotemia, polyuria and polydipsia, anorexia and weight loss, lethargy, pale mucous membranes and ulcers. Vomiting and sometimes convulsions occur in the dog.
4. In blood tests during azotemia, urea concentration increases, and creatinine or other non-protein nitrogen compounds can be seen.
5. Blood tests during uremia show higher creatinine and urea nitrogen levels.

Treatment measures for kidney failure in dogs

1. It is extremely difficult to cure kidney failure with current treatment methods. However, appropriate drug treatment can improve the quality of life of sick dogs for months or even years.
2. Diet therapy can meet the nutritional and energy needs of sick dogs, improve the clinical symptoms of uremia, reduce electrolyte, vitamin and mineral disorders, thereby slowing down the process of renal failure.
3. When a sick dog vomits, maintain normal hydration and avoid stress reactions by not restricting drinking water or rehydration. Give sodium bicarbonate to correct metabolic acidosis, give anabolic agents and intestinal phosphorus binders, supply calcium and calcitriol, oral analgesics and H2 antagonists, give erythropoietin, anticonvulsants, without poisoning the kidneys Drugs that act and develop antihypertensive treatments.
4. When dogs develop uremic renal failure, it is recommended to drink water freely, take in normal protein, and limit phosphorus binders. Hypertension restricts sodium and supplies potassium to prevent excessive potassium loss. In addition, consider using erythropoietin and vitamin D supplementation when anemia occurs.

Precautions for dog kidney failure

The main functions of the kidney are excretion (such as protein metabolism waste), regulation (such as acid-base balance) and biosynthesis (such as erythropoietin). Only after the kidney tissue has been extensively destroyed, clinical symptoms are obviously exposed. Therefore, elderly dogs should pay attention to physical examination.
